The square knot does not have Property 2R

Let QS3Q\subset S^3 be the square knot, and let Property 2R2R mean that whenever QQ is a component of a 22-component link whose integral surgery yields

#2(S1×S2),\#_{2}(S^1\times S^2),

a sequence of handle slides converts the link into a 00-framed unlink. Square-knot Property 2R conjecture. The square knot does not have Property 2R2R. This proposed counterexample is motivated by a family of links whose surgery yields #2(S1×S2)\#_2(S^1\times S^2) and by the apparent difficulty of trivializing the associated presentations; the source presents it as a question motivated by evidence, not as an established result.
